Mammoths Shut Out Unicorns 3-0 Behind Vieaux’s Complete Game

UTICA, Mich. – The Westside Woolly Mammoths (15-17) secured a 3-0 victory over the Utica Unicorns (15-15) on Saturday afternoon at Jimmy John’s Field, fueled by a dominant pitching performance and timely power at the plate.

Left-hander Cam Vieaux went the distance for the Mammoths, tossing six shutout innings while scattering five hits and striking out four. Vieaux did not issue a walk, improving to 2-0 on the season and lowering his ERA in the process.

The Mammoths struck quickly in the third inning, plating all three of their runs. Tommy Stevenson broke the scoreless tie with a solo home run, and two batters later, Anthony Sharkas launched a two-run shot to left-center, driving in Sebastian Trinidad. That would prove to be all the offense Westside needed.

The Unicorns threatened with five hits but were stifled by strong Mammoths defense, which turned three double plays to erase potential rallies.

With the win, the Mammoths move to 15-17 on the season, while the Unicorns fall to 15-15.

Notable Performers:

  • Alex Harrell (UU): 2-for-3
  • Cam Vieaux (WWM): 6.0 IP, 5 H, 0 R, 4 K, 0 BB (Win, 2-0)
  • Anthony Sharkas (WWM): 1-for-3, HR, 2 RBI
  • Tommy Stevenson (WWM): 1-for-2, HR, RBI
